Woods’ Injury to Cause Network Pain

Jun 19, 2008  •  Post A Comment

Tiger Wood’s season-ending injury is also expected to cause some pain at the networks that broadcast golf because ratings fade when he’s not in tournaments, the New York Times reports. The network that may miss him most is Comcast’s Golf Channel, the Times says. Most commercials for golf events are already sold, the Wall Street Journal says. When ratings inevitably decline, the networks will be on the hook for make-good spots, the paper says.
